Naturalistic observation is a research method where scientists study behavior in its real-world setting without interfering or controlling variables Its biggest strength is ecological validity, meaning the findings reflect how people (or animals) actually behave in everyday life Its biggest weakness is the inability to establish cause and effect Below is a detailed look at both sides What
